Featured project: Eau Claire Drive

This full interior refresh included updates to the kitchen, den, and guest bath, with every detail chosen to better reflect the homeowners’ style and the way they live.

The result: A warm, welcoming space with timeless finishes, thoughtful storage, and a natural flow from room to room — proof that good design should feel as easy as it looks.

In the kitchenwe installed iron ore cabinetry with warm brass hardware for a modern yet classic palette. The quartz backsplash and countertops give it an effortless, polished feel. Open walnut shelving adds contrast and everyday practicality, while updated pendant lighting brings a sculptural touch.

For the guest bathroom, a custom, vintage vanity in rich walnut anchors the space, topped with a quartz counter and soft gold plumbing fixtures. We incorporated the homeowners heirloom geometric mirror, new globe sconces, zellige tile backsplash with a brass cap, and terrazzo floor to add just the right touch of personality.

Their den has become the most versatile room, serving as a gathering space for visiting family and friends as well as nights in. The custom built-ins with reeded glass front and cross-style wine storage create a striking focal point. A crisp white-painted brick fireplace with a warm walnut wood mantel adds balance and warmth. The coffered ceiling and recessed lighting give the room height, brightness, and architectural interest.
